Superintendent's office details 2024–25 staff allocation, enrollment and vacancy shifts
Summary
District administrators presented the board with the staffing allocation report for the 2024–25 school year, showing October 1 enrollment of 3,838, 35 certificated hires and program shifts that added special-education staffing and a one-year instructional coach funded by a grant.
District administrators presented the board with the current staffing allocation for 2024–25 on Jan. 15, outlining hires, program shifts and how October 1 enrollment figures affected staffing decisions.
The presenter (listed in meeting materials as the staffing lead) told the board that October 1 enrollment for the district was 3,838 students, below a projected 3,854 figure used during planning. Between the October 2023 and October 2024 snapshots staff reported hiring 35 certificated employees and 11 non-certificated employees; the presentation noted that about 32 of the certificated hires were regular contracted positions…
